Details

Profumo

Perfume

Intense, elegant and complex with notes of small black fruits, black cherry, rhubarb and chocolate.

Colore

Color

Ruby red with brilliant hues of purple.

Gusto

Taste

Excellent impact with a velvety harmony, silky and fresh, persistent long-lasting finish.

Serve at:

18 - 20 °C.

Longevity:

10 - 15 years

Decanting time:

1 hour

Tradition and discipline. Lightness and passion. Care for the landscape, art and community. Sustainability and experimentation. With a pop art stroke and a carefree touch. Since 1956, Michele Chiarlo has been vinifying the essence of Piedmont, loving and developing the most incredible wine region in the world. They cultivate 110 hectares of vineyards between the Langhe, Monferrato, and Gavi areas, within them the finest crus while fully respecting the ecological criteria, terroir, and their expression. Origin Castelnuovo Calcea
Climate Altitude: 250 m. a.s.l. Exposure: South / South-Southwest.
Soil composition Called the ‘astiane sands’’, it consists of calcareous clay marl of sedimentary marine origin, with good presence of lime and sand, rich in microelements, in particular magnesium.
Cultivation system Guyot
Plants per hectare Approximately 5,000.
Yield per hectare Very low yield; thinning of excess bunches at end of summer, leaving an average of 5/6 bunches per vine.
Harvest Manual harvest.
Fermentation temperature 27-30 °C
Wine making Fermentation in oak vats with maceration for approximately 20 days with the skins, the last 10 using the “submerged cap” system, at a temperature between 27 °C and 30 °C.
Aging Minimum of 3 years, oak-aged for 2 months before refinement in the bottle.
Year production 3000 bottles
